About

Sungkono Sungkono is a researcher at the forefront of robotics and automation, with a particular focus on mobile robot control, sensor fusion, and computer vision applications. His work bridges the gap between theoretical control systems and practical, real-world implementations—from improving the motion accuracy of differential drive robots to developing vision algorithms for critical nuclear fuel inspection. Sungkono's research on "Differential Drive Mobile Robot Motion Accuracy Improvement with Odometry-Compass Sensor Fusion" (2023) demonstrates his commitment to enhancing autonomous vehicle stability through robust sensor integration. Notably, his 2021 study on a "Computer vision algorithm for identifying the post-irradiated nuclear fuel in a hotcell" showcases the application of robotic vision in high-stakes environments, where manipulators must precisely handle hazardous materials. His foundational work on "Sistem Kendali Gerak Robot Menggunakan PC Berbasis Bluetooth" (2020) has garnered 4 citations, reflecting early interest in accessible robot control systems.
